Super Farm is a party video game with a farmyard theme developed by Asobo Studio and published by Ignition Entertainment for the PlayStation 2. The game was re-released for Windows 8 in 2013 to commemorate its 10th anniversary.
Black Mirror is a dark adventure game that details the aftermath of the tragic death of William Gordon. Playing as his grandson Samuel players must unveil the truth behind the events of that fateful, stormy night.

Following the almost universally acclaimed short-attention-span action of the Game Boy Advance's WarioWare, Inc.: Mega Microgame$! comes this party-game adaptation for GameCube. Many of the mini-games featured in the handheld original have been converted for four-player competition on the console. Gamers strive to be the quickest teeth-brushers, the most precise nose pickers, the best free-throwers, the most accurate apple shooters, the most skillful paper-airplane pilots, and the victors in countless other quick contests that take no more than a few seconds to complete.
As in the GBA original, a wide variety of activities combine with a simple, unifying theme, for an experience designed to appeal instantly to anyone who played video games in the days before 3D graphics and complicated storylines. Half the fun is in not knowing which five-second challenge will pop up next, or what the player will be required to do in it. The third instalment of the Pro Evolution Soccer series, with improved graphics and a bigger Master League, which was split into four zones, with two divisions and cup competitions in each zone. Other than most of the Italian teams, club names, as are many of the players, are fictional. However, the game has an improved edit mode so players can edit the team's name, flag, logo, team shirts, and stadium.
The shop system can unlock hidden features such as classic teams. The game also has a training and a challenge mode, in which players must dribble around cones as quickly as possible. Replays can be fast-forwarded and rewound, and the view can be rotated. The advantage rule was implemented, so a foul only stops play if the fouled team suffers for it.
Garrulismo is a Doom II megawad created by Eye del Cul. It contains 32 maps and was first released on October 16, 2003. Its title is Spanish and can be loosely translated to "thuggery", and the mod's irreverent tone contains many references to popular Spanish media and pop culture, seen most prominently in its humorous story. The title screen features popular Spanish singer José Luis Cantero Rada and comedian Chiquito de la Calzada.
One Piece: Chopper's Big Adventure is a Japanese role-playing game for the Wonderswan handheld featuring characters from the popular anime and manga series One Piece. It was developed by Bandai and released on October 16, 2003 by Bandai Namco.
Batman: Rise of Sin Tzu is a 2003 beat 'em up video game released for the Xbox, PlayStation 2, Game Boy Advance and GameCube consoles. It was developed and published by Ubisoft in conjunction with Warner Bros. Interactive Entertainment and DC Comics. It is based on the television series The New Batman Adventures and is a sequel to the game Batman: Vengeance

An ancient prophecy foretells that the Moon Juju, the kind protector of the Pupanunu people, would be weakened by the evil Tlaloc, an embittered Pupanunu shaman, so he could turn the Pupanunu people into sheep as revenge for not being made high shaman in favor of another shaman, Jibolba. The prophecy also mentions a great and mighty warrior who would restore the Moon Juju, defeat Tlaloc, and bring peace to the Pupanunu people.
Having escaped Tlaloc's spell, Jibolba believes his apprentice Lok to be the warrior of the prophecy and prepares to send him off; however, it appears that Lok has been turned into a sheep. Jibolba sends his younger apprentice, Tak (voiced by Jason Marsden), to find magical plants and change him back, though it turns out not to be Lok. Jibolba tells Tak to obtain the Spirit Rattle, which allows the wielder to communicate with powerful Juju spirits to assist him, while he finds Lok.

Based off a combination of the popular Disneyland attraction and the 2003 movie of the same name, players guide Zeke Holloway through the house of 999 happy haunts in order to solve a mystery, put the spirits to rest, and get out of the house alive.
The game is presented as a 3rd person action adventure. Players are allowed full roam of the mansion, once they collect enough Shriveled Souls inside their Beacon of Souls, a special lantern designed to collect the various lesser ghosts throughout the rooms. Though Zeke handles his quest alone, he is aided by the help of Madame Leota, and six friendly ghosts who will provide hints and items throughout the journey. As Zeke solves puzzles, completes various tasks, and helps rid the house of its evil spirits, these spiritual companions will provide Soul Gems, which amplify the power of the Soul Beacon. Once fully charged, Zeke will have the ability to face the main spirit, Atticus Thorn, for the final showdown.
Disney's 101 Dalmatians II: Patch's London Adventure is a single-player game in which you play as Patch, a Dalmatian puppy who wants to be more than just "one of the 101." Patch's goal is to find and ultimately save his Dalmatian puppy brothers and sisters, who have fallen into the clutches of the dastardly Cruella De Vil.
Based on MTV's claymation animation show Celebrity Deathmatch. You play a series of wrestling matches, much in the style of other wrestling games. The twist being, that you play one of various celebrities, such as Marilyn Manson and Carmen Electra. Various weapons appear in the ring during play, such as a chainsaw and crossbow. The game is set out in 6 "episodes" of 3 matches each, and you can play either of the celebrities in each match.
